The Iranian Nuclear Program: A Race Against Time

The article references the Institute for Science and International Security (ISIS) report, which underscores Iran’s significant progress in its nuclear program. They are concerned with the percentage of uranium enriched to weapons grade. Iran has already enriched uranium up to 60%, dangerously close to the 90% needed for a nuclear weapon. This rapid advancement, coupled with Iran’s reluctance to cooperate fully with international inspections, has fueled international concern.

The Proposed Ceasefire: What’s on the Table?

The latest US-brokered plan envisions a phased approach. The initial stage involves a 60-day pause in fighting, along with the exchange of hostages for Palestinian prisoners. The proposal also includes provisions for humanitarian aid to reach Gaza. The ultimate goal is to establish a permanent ceasefire, which would see the remaining hostages released.

The Ongoing Legal Battles at the ICC

Recently, Israel‘s request to withdraw arrest warrants against former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u and ex-Defense Minister Yoav Gallant has come under scrutiny. Submitted by Israeli Attorney General Gilad Noam, the request highlights the complex legal entanglements surrounding the International Criminal Court (ICC). This case is a reflection of broader geopolitical struggles and legal interpretations on the international stage. As tensions between Israel and the ICC intensify, future legal proceedings may set significant precedents for international law.

Debates Over Jurisdiction

Israel remains steadfast in its stance that the ICC, based in The Hague, lacks jurisdiction over these matters. Israeli officials argue that the evidence against alleged war crimes in Gaza does not meet the criteria set by the ICC. These arguments hinge upon the interpretation of international law and the sovereignty of nations, which might influence future ICC decisions globally. Humanitarian Concerns Amid Conflict

The conflict in Gaza, originating from a Hamas incursion on October 7, 2023, resulted in significant civilian casualties and ongoing humanitarian crises. With 59 hostages still unaccounted for amidst reports of over 52,000 lives lost, the conflict underscores the dire need for sustainable resolutions. The Global Ripple Effects of Tariff Changes

April 2nd marked a pivotal moment in modern trade policy as the U.S. announced significant tariffs on imports from nearly every country. With rates as high as 20% on European goods and 34% on Chinese products, the financial markets immediately reacted, indicating the far-reaching implications of these policies. This move is part of a wider strategy to renegotiate trade deals in favor of domestic industries, but it also carries the risk of escalating trade tensions and economic slowdowns.
